Iran’s new impotent supreme leader releases first statement — after reports emerge he is in coma, had leg amputated

Iran’s new supreme leader, Mojtaba Khamenei, released his first statement Thursday — after reports circulated that he was in a coma and had his leg amputated after being severely injured in the US-Israeli strikes that killed his father.

The message was read out on Iranian state TV by an anchor as an image of Khameni was displayed.

Iran’s new supreme leader, Mojtaba Khamenei, released his first statement Thursday, after reports circulated that he was in a coma and had his leg amputated after being severely injured. via REUTERS Khamenei still hasn’t been seen in public since he was appointed as his father’s successor earlier this week.
